GTM Systems Analyst

Figma

Full-time
USA
$102k-$215k per year

The GTM Systems Analyst is responsible for optimizing, scaling, and governing Salesforce to support various cross functional teams. This role combines business analysis, systems expertise, data stewardship, and cross-functional partnership to drive operational excellence across Sales, Customer Experience, Marketing, Legal, Product and Finance.

This individual operates independently, understands complex initiatives end-to-end, and serves as a trusted advisor to business stakeholders on CRM automation, reporting, and process design. 

This is a full time role that can be held from one of our US hubs or remotely in the United States. 

What you’ll do at Figma:

  • Serve as the primary point of contact for Salesforce operational and process questions across Sales, Marketing, Customer Experience, Legal, Product, and Finance, ensuring timely and structured resolution of requests

  • Triage, investigate, and resolve Salesforce inquiries, identifying root causes of recurring issues and implementing scalable process improvements

  • Define, document, and maintain standardized Salesforce workflows to reduce ambiguity and improve cross-functional efficiency

  • Partner with Salesforce Developers to scope, test, and deploy system enhancements, ensuring work is tracked, validated through UAT, and released on schedule

  • Maintain Salesforce data integrity by auditing data quality, refining data governance processes, and monitoring system updates that impact customer records

  • Drive Salesforce adoption by improving user experience, building reports and dashboards, and maintaining clear system documentation

  • Balance day-to-day support with strategic initiatives, managing multiple concurrent projects and release timelines

We'd love to hear from you if you have:

  • 3+ years of experience as a Salesforce Administrator in a Sales or Revenue organization

  • Hands-on experience configuring Salesforce, including custom objects, formula fields, flows, validation rules, reports, and dashboards

  • Experience supporting CPQ, Revenue Cloud, or similar quote-to-cash workflows

  • Working knowledge of Salesforce data architecture and basic proficiency in SOQL or SQL

  • Demonstrated experience managing multiple concurrent projects and system enhancements independently

  • Experience creating and maintaining system documentation for technical and non-technical collaborators

While not required, it’s an added plus if you also have:

  • Salesforce Administrator or related certifications

  • Experience supporting a SaaS go-to-market business model

  • Experience working in a SCRUM or agile environment

  • Familiarity with Salesforce Revenue Cloud or Partner Ecosystem Management

Pay Transparency Disclosure

If based in Figma’s San Francisco or New York hub offices, this role has the annual base salary range stated below.    

Job level and actual compensation will be decided based on factors including, but not limited to, individual qualifications objectively assessed during the interview process (including skills and prior relevant experience, potential impact, and scope of role), market demands, and specific work location. The listed range is a guideline, and the range for this role may be modified. For roles that are available to be filled remotely, the pay range is localized according to employee work location by a factor of between 80% and 100% of range. Please discuss your specific work location with your recruiter for more information. 

Figma offers equity to employees, as well a competitive package of additional benefits, including health, dental & vision, retirement with company contribution, parental leave & reproductive or family planning support, mental health & wellness benefits, generous PTO, company recharge days, a learning & development stipend, a work from home stipend, and cell phone reimbursement.  Figma also offers sales incentive pay for most sales roles and an annual bonus plan for eligible non-sales roles. Figma’s compensation and benefits are subject to change and may be modified in the future.

Annual Base Salary Range:

$102,000—$215,000 USD
